Avatar billede meyer Nybegynder
06. oktober 1999 - 16:15 Der er 3 kommentarer og
1 løsning

Automatisk datoskift??

Jeg har denne her:

SQL="SELECT * FROM news Where (Dato < date()) AND (Dato > #30-09-99#) ORDER BY Dato DESC"

Den virker fint, men i stedet for at jeg manuelt har indtastet #30-09-99# vil jeg gerne have den til selv at indsætte sidste måneds sidste dato, er der nogen der kan klare det??

Meyer
Avatar billede skall Nybegynder
06. oktober 1999 - 16:53 #1
Hej Dan

Prøv med:

<%
  DaysInMonth=Date
  CurrentDate=Day(DaysInMonth)
  BeginMonth=DateAdd("d",-(CurrentDate-1),DaysInMonth)
  EndMonth=(DateAdd("m",1, BeginMonth)-1)
  TotalDays=Day(EndMonth)
%>

<%=Response.Write(TotalDays)%>
Avatar billede ulrik Nybegynder
06. oktober 1999 - 17:10 #2
DateStr = DateAdd("d",-Day(Date()+1)+1,Date)

SQL="SELECT * FROM news Where (Dato < date()) AND (Dato > " & DateStr & ") ORDER BY Dato DESC"
Avatar billede ulrik Nybegynder
06. oktober 1999 - 17:10 #3
Det skulle virke:)
Avatar billede meyer Nybegynder
06. oktober 1999 - 17:16 #4
Thomas>>>den kom desværre med sidste dag i denne måned :o(

Ulrik>> Tak :o)
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Kurser inden for grundlæggende programmering

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ester